To get the required effect with Observer use about 8-12 no more no less. In fact if you ever want to use them on a unit you won't move you don't need a trigger. Place them in a circle around the static unit, and if Computer Owned (No Ai) they will go to the centre and go in a small circle in the middle. Thus saving trigger usage.

cameo:
Noun
Inflected forms: pl.cam·e·os 1. a. A gem or shell carved in relief, especially one in which the raised design and the background consist of layers of contrasting colors. b. The technique of carving in this way. c. A medallion with a profile cut in raised relief. 2. A brief vivid portrayal or depiction: a literary cameo. 3. A brief appearance of a prominent actor, as in a single scene of a motion picture. Also called cameo role.
Verb
Inflected forms: cam·e·oed, cam·e·o·ing, cam·e·os
Verb
tr. 1. To make into or like a gem or shell carved in relief. 2. To portray in sharp, delicate relief, as in a literary composition.
Verb
intr. To make a brief appearance, as in a film: She cameoed as Anne Boleyn in A Man for All Seasons.
Etymology
Italian cameo, and Middle English cameu (from Old French camaieu, and and Medieval Latin camah*tus ).
